The mint know the destination but not who is sending it, correct. This is an intricacy of how LN works, there is a potential but complicated solution for this and that's source-based routing.
In principle, a Cashu wallet could contrusct the onion themselves and pass it on to the mint, much like how hosted channels work. It requires running almost a full Lightning client on the wallet side though.

Good analogy for how Chaumian mints work:
You enter a casino and buy poker chips with Lightning. The chips all look the same. You can pass those chips around to other players.
When go back home, you give the chips back at the counter and get your money back on Lightning.

PSA: as long as you're not using a Cashu wallet that can be restored from a seed phrase (currently: Nutshell-py, Nutstash Alpha, soon: all of them), things could go wrong and you could lose ecash due to some weird bug. Please treat it with care and only use small amounts. I'm very serious about this. I don't hold more than a few dollars worth of ecash myself in non-deterministic (seedless) wallets.
BUT HERE IS THE GOOD NEWS:
Determinisitc wallets are so much safer. Even if something goes wrong, you can just revert time and restore your entire balance.

For the second half of this year, I will focus a lot more on integrating Cashu with Nostr and really identifying the strongest possible synergies:
- wallet to mint communication via nostr (IP privacy)
- user-to-user nostr contact lists, ecash transfers, ecash inboxes
- nostr wallet connect with ecash wallets
- collaborative wallet protocols for proof of liability checks
- and possibly more!
